iT邦幫忙

0

python flask 登錄系統

請問一下如何用python製作網站的登錄系統(我是個小白)

你應該是去找一本書來學,而不是用問的
https://www.books.com.tw/products/0010793455
froce iT邦大師 1 級 ‧ 2021-07-19 09:49:45 檢舉
這個問題你必須學到什麼是session,什麼是cookie...
這裡只能簡單的回答你流程。

1. 使用者進入網頁,輸入帳號及密碼
2. 伺服器檢查帳號密碼正不正確,正確的話紀錄使用者資訊在伺服器上,存在session裡,並設置過期時間
3. 伺服器回應使用者,並且設定cookie(裡面存有seesion的識別紀錄/ID),儲存到使用者的瀏覽器裡
4. 使用者接下來每次瀏覽,就會順帶送出所持有的cookie,伺服器藉著cookie裡面存的seesion ID去比對這是哪個使用者,有沒有過期需要重新登入。

一般來說網站登入的流程大致是這樣。實做的話...
我用Django的沒這個困擾。flask就要自己去找適合你的實做套件比較方便...
感謝各位
圖片
  直播研討會
圖片
{{ item.channelVendor }} {{ item.webinarstarted }} |
{{ formatDate(item.duration) }}
直播中

1 個回答

0
海綿寶寶
iT邦大神 1 級 ‧ 2021-07-19 08:44:46

可以參考這篇
先完全百分之一百照做
可以執行之後
再逐漸調整成你要的結果

我要發表回答

立即登入回答